Output e01072402c62f9e4f38cdaaa3e2eecab87abbd095b9df4e9c082b5a0ee69b2c2:18

value
40621762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b0649f302a2cc2a5d6e678cf2e2c90b77bab7c OP_EQUAL
address
MLBL694Gdev5psnEtVmzMSGsiRLVdQNe5U
transaction
e01072402c62f9e4f38cdaaa3e2eecab87abbd095b9df4e9c082b5a0ee69b2c2
spent
true